Injured driver's car flipped '˜several times' during crash on main road into Northampton
This article contains affiliate links. We may earn a small commission on items purchased through this article, but that does not affect our editorial judgement.
Emergency services were called to a westbound stretch of the A45 between Wilby Way and Great Doddington following the crash at around 6.40pm on Saturday (November 26).
A police spokeswoman said that, “for reasons unknown,” the car rolled several times and hit the central reservation. No other cars were involved in the collision.

Hide AdThe driver was left with serious head injuries and taken to University Hospitals Coventry.
As the road was covered in debris, the both directions had to be closed while the carriageway was cleared.
Northamptonshire Police is appealing for witnesses to the crash and is set to launch a formal appeal later today.
